Metabolite-based dietary supplementation in human type 1 diabetes is associated with microbiota and immune modulation

2021-09-22

Abstract excerpt

<h4>Background</h4> Short-chain fatty acids (SCFAs) produced by the gut microbiota have beneficial anti-inflammatory and gut homeostasis effects and prevent type 1 diabetes (T1D) in mice. Reduced SCFA production indicates a loss of beneficial bacteria, commonly associated with chronic autoimmune and inflammatory diseases, including T1D and type 2 diabetes.
